Solving 2245÷69
-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:
2245÷69=2245×96
- Multiply the Numerators: 45×6=270
- Multiply the Denominators: 22×9=198
- Form the New Fraction: 2245×69=198270
Let's Simplify 198270
-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 270 and 198. The GCD of 270 and 198 is 18.
-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:198÷18270÷18=1115
Answer 2245÷69=1115
